Saif Ali Khan out of danger after surgery, knife removed from spine: Doctors

Bollywood actor Saif Ali Khan underwent surgery on Thursday at a Mumbai hospital to remove a knife lodged in his spine after being repeatedly stabbed by an intruder at his residence. Doctors have confirmed that Khan, 54, is now “out of danger” and on the path to recovery.

The emergency surgery was performed at Lilavati Hospital, where Khan was rushed following the incident that occurred around 2:30 am at his home in the ‘Satguru Sharan’ building.

Dr Niraj Uttamani, Chief Operating Officer (COO) at Lilavati Hospital, informed reporters, “We removed a 2.5-inch piece of knife from the spine.” He explained that the actor had suffered two severe injuries, two intermediate wounds, and two abrasions.

“Fortunately, Saif Ali Khan’s surgery went very well. He is recovering and has been shifted to the ICU. He may be moved to the ward within a day or two,” Dr Uttamani stated.

The injuries were deep, but the surgical team successfully managed the procedure. Dr Uttamani further revealed that both neurosurgery and plastic surgery were performed. “Khan is looking fine and is on a 100 per cent recovery path as per our initial assessment,” he added.

Dr Nitin Dange, a neurosurgeon at Lilavati Hospital, elaborated that Khan had sustained a significant injury to his thoracic spine. “A knife lodged in his spine caused a major injury. Surgery was performed to remove the knife and repair the leaking spinal fluid. Additionally, two deep wounds—one on his left hand and another on the right side of his neck—were repaired by the plastic surgery team,” Dr Dange explained.

“Khan is now completely stable, in recovery mode, and out of danger. We plan to shift him out of the ICU tomorrow morning, with a possible discharge within a day or two,” Dr Dange concluded.
